Hi monterey, here is a full draw pic of the bow

(http://i861.photobucket.com/albums/ab173/07Hawaii/IMG_1628_zps039844df.jpg)

The draw weight is 50@28, the lams have no taper at all and the overall stack is 0.410". The bow has a mild defelex/reflex-profile. The bow is 64" NTN and the riser is 17" long. Here is a pic of the form

(http://i861.photobucket.com/albums/ab173/07Hawaii/IMG_1598.jpg)

To make the ends of the limbs stiff I glued in a 12" wedge that goes from zero to 1.25" in thickness

(http://i861.photobucket.com/albums/ab173/07Hawaii/IMG_1645.jpg)

It's a nice shooting bow, but I think by making the working section about 2" shorter I could make it a bit more performant.
